Output df3389ea259391a526e283bcc7da101d4ed2fd6e3182eebff8884a2740ffae68:31

value
10772267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03e3fa5991cbcde69be452c51618c0332c6c75d3 OP_EQUAL
address
M8FjNBy5BFETQFoguMgUTaqVieKmbbeKPj
transaction
df3389ea259391a526e283bcc7da101d4ed2fd6e3182eebff8884a2740ffae68
spent
true